In this article, we will formulate a Padres vs Phillies prediction for this MLB doubleheader on Wednesday, July 2, at Citizens Bank Park in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ania. Let’s take a look at the prediction for this MLB matchup.

San Diego Padres Betting Preview

The San Diego Padres (45-39, 20-25 Away) have been playing in a hot and cold form lately, but they managed to win back-to-back series against the Kansas City Royals and Washington Nationals before losing to the Cincinnati Reds. The Padres lost the opening game of the current series against the Phillies, failing to score in a 4-0 defeat despite having seven hits opposite Philadelphia’s six. Matt Waldron took the loss after allowing four runs on six hits with three strikeouts and six walks in 4.2 innings.

This year, the Padres average 4.11 runs per game (23rd in the MLB) on a .247/.314/.378 triple-slash. When it comes to pitching, the Padres’ staff has a 3.65 ERA (8th) and 1.22 WHIP (8th). Gavin Sheets leads the Padres with a .264 batting average, 13 home runs, and 49 RBI this season.

The projected starting pitcher for the Padres in Game 1 of this doubleheader is Nick Pivetta, who is 8-2 in 16 starts this season, with a 3.36 ERA and 1.03 WHIP in 91.0 innings. Dylan Cease will take the mound in Game 2; he has a 3-7 record in 17 starts this year with a 4.53 ERA and 1.32 WHIP in 91.1 innings.

Philadelphia Phillies Betting Preview

The Philadelphia Phillies (50-35, 27-14 Home) were on a four-series winning streak before suffering a sweep at the hands of the Houston Astros. The Phillies did respond with a win over the divisional rivals, the Atlanta Braves, and then opened this series against the Padres with a 4-0 victory. Zack Wheeler got the win after allowing no runs on six hits with ten strikeouts and no walks across 8.0 innings of work.

This season, the Phillies average 4.59 runs per game (12th in the MLB) on a .254/.329/.401 triple-slash. When it comes to pitching, the Phillies’ staff has a 3.72 ERA (9th) and 1.26 WHIP (16th). Kyle Schwarber leads the Phillies with a .250 batting average, 25 home runs, and 57 RBI this season.

Mick Abel will take the mound for the Phillies in Game 1 of this doubleheader on Wednesday. The 23-year-old right-hander has a 2-1 record in five starts this year with a 3.47 ERA and 1.16 WHIP in 23.1 innings. Christopher Sanchez will start Game 2; he has a 6-2 record in 16 starts this year with a 2.79 ERA and 1.16 WHIP in 93.2 innings.

Padres vs Phillies Prediction

The Phillies won eight of the previous ten H2H encounters, including seven of the last eight. I am backing the Padres to take Game 1 of the doubleheader because of the pitching matchup and the fact that they failed to score in the opening game of the series and will be desperate to improve. Nick Pivetta was far from impressive in June (a 4.71 ERA), but he did register two quality starts in his last three and shut the Nationals out in his most recent start. Also, Pivetta is way more experienced than rookie Mick Abel, so I am going with the Padres.

In Game 2, I am backing the Phillies. Christopher Sanchez has five consecutive quality starts, all in June, when he recorded a fantastic 1.85 ERA. Sanchez hasn’t allowed more than two runs in his previous six starts, and I doubt he will now against San Diego’s struggling offense. Dylan Cease, on the other hand, surrendered 3+ runs in six of his last eight starts and ten in his previous three, so I am backing the Phillies to get to him early on.

Oliver Zivic's Pick: Game 1: Padres ML / Game 2: Phillies ML
